Memac Ogilvy wins big at Dubai Lynx Awards '14
Published in The Saudi Gazette on 19 - 03 - 2014

DUBAI – Memac Ogilvy showed off its creative muscles by winning 46 awards at this year's Dubai Lynx Awards, the Oscars of the advertising and communications industry in the Middle East.
The winning included 2 Grand Prix, 14 Gold, 23 Silver and 7 Bronze awards on top of the 72 shortlists and underpinned an amazing night for the agency as its Chairman and CEO, Edmond Moutran, received the prestigious Dubai Lynx Advertising Person 2014 Award.
The evening was capped by the unprecedented feat of winning both the Network of the Year and the company's Dubai office was named Agency of the Year.
“2014 caps a remarkable journey for us,” said Moutran. “We started life 30 years ago this year, with one client and four staff. Today, we have shown once again that we are the region's most creative communications agency. I could not be more proud of everyone at Memac Ogilvy.”
The night's big winners were “Mobilizing the 12th Man” campaign from Memac Ogilvy Label Tunisia which won two grand prix as well as 4 gold, 2 silver and 1 bronze trophies. Memac Ogilvy Dubai campaign for UN Women – Autocomplete Truth – was also recognized with nearly thirteen awards in ten different categories.
The gala evening also included a special award for Memac Ogilvy as Eddie Moutran received the Dubai Lynx Advertising Person 2014 accolade. This honorary award, selected by the organizers of Dubai Lynx, is presented to an individual who has made significant contributions to advancing the reputation and profile of the communications industry in the MENA region.

Moutran said: “Dubai Lynx is the guardian of creativity in the Middle East and I am deeply honored to receive this award from them. I follow humbly in the footsteps of those who have received this award before me.”
“Our industry has changed beyond recognition since I founded Memac 30 years ago in Bahrain,” he continued. “I am proud to have played a small part in putting the creative talent this region possess on the global map and showing the world that great ideas are great ideas wherever they originate. I'd also like to thank all of the talented staff, and our incredibly supportive clients. This honor is as much theirs as it is mine.” — SG
